Interactions of nanocrystalline tin oxide powder with NO2: A Raman spectroscopic study

Academic Article
Publication Date:
2007
abstract:
The interaction of nanocrystalline tin oxide and titanium oxide powders with NO2-containing atmosphere has been followed as a function of temperature by Raman spectroscopy. New bands appearing in the 800-1600 cm(-1) range have been observed and attributed to various adsorbates. The responsibility of adsorbed nitrites in the sensor resistance change is proposed.
